On average across the year,
yes, Luxembourg is hotter than
Kitchener, Ontario
.
Luxembourg has an average temperature of 10°C/50°F and Kitchener, Ontario has an average temperature of 7°C/45°F.
Luxembourg's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 23°C/73°F, which is not hotter than Kitchener, Ontario's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 26°C/79°F).
On average across the year, no, Luxembourg is not colder than Kitchener, Ontario . Luxembourg has an average minimum temperature of 7°C/45°F and Kitchener, Ontario has an average minimum temperature of 3°C/37°F.
On average across the year,
no, Luxembourg has less rain than
Kitchener, Ontario. Luxembourg has an average annual rainfall of 863mm and Kitchener, Ontario has an average annual rainfall of 1104mm.
Luxembourg's wettest month is December, with an average monthly rainfall of 92mm, which is drier than Kitchener, Ontario's wettest month (October, with an average monthly rainfall of 122mm).
